Riyadh Cables Group has been awarded a contract by DEWA to supply, install, test, and commission 132kV cable works for the Maktoumi and Sukkari substations, covering a 41km route with 246km of cables. The 27-month project aims to enhance power connectivity in Dubai's Jabal Ali Palm area, reflecting DEWA's trust in the company's expertise and commitment to sustainable energy infrastructure.

ADNOC signed a Strategic Collaboration Agreement with MoIAT, ADDED, ADIO, and ADDCI to enhance local manufacturing and integrate SMEs into its supply chain, fostering innovation and economic diversification. The initiative aligns with UAE’s Operation 300bn and aims to boost industrial growth, strengthen supply chains, and reduce reliance on imports. ADNOC also plans to drive AED 200 billion ($54.5 billion) into the UAE economy over five years through its In-Country Value program.

EDF France announced plans to develop a 5GW pumped-storage hydropower plant in Ras Al Khaimah, UAE, to enhance energy storage and stability. The project, highlighted at the Ras Al Khaimah Municipality Department Energy Summit, aims to align with UAE's Net Zero goals. EDF is also involved in a 250MW hydroelectric project at Hatta Dam, set for completion in early 2025.

ADNOC signed a 15-year Sales and Purchase Agreement with Malaysia’s PETRONAS to supply 1 million tonnes per annum of lower-carbon LNG from the Ruwais LNG project, starting in 2028. This partnership enhances ADNOC's role as a reliable energy supplier and supports Asia's demand for cleaner energy. The Ruwais LNG facility will use clean power, making it one of the lowest-carbon LNG plants globally.

ADNOC Gas has awarded Worley Engineering the Front End Engineering and Design (FEED) contract for the Bab Gas Cap (BGC) project in Abu Dhabi. The project aims to increase ADNOC Gas’ processing capacity by 20%, adding over 1.8 billion standard cubic feet per day, and includes facilities for gas processing, CO₂ capture, and sulphur recovery. Worley will execute the services from its Abu Dhabi office, leveraging global expertise.

Alfanar has secured SAR 20 billion in strategic contracts with Saudi Electricity Company to deliver the Middle East’s largest high-voltage direct current (HVDC) project, advancing renewable integration and grid stability across Saudi Arabia. The 7 GW transmission link will connect key regions, supporting Vision 2030’s energy goals and enhancing the nation’s infrastructure for sustainable energy advancements.

Nakheel and DEWA have partnered on a AED270 million project to build two high-capacity 132/11 KV substations with a combined 400 MVA capacity, designed to power the luxury villas and waterfront developments of Palm Jebel Ali. This initiative supports Dubai’s growth, aligns with the D33 Economic Agenda, and contributes to expanding the city’s future growth corridor in the Jebel Ali area.

Tadweer Group and the Uzbekistan Government have signed a joint development agreement to establish a waste-to-energy plant in the Navoi and Bukhara regions, aiming to promote sustainable development, circular economy principles, and renewable energy production. This partnership strengthens UAE-Uzbekistan collaboration toward a net-zero future.
